Four of Llandaff North’s Women’s players have been selected for the 2015 Six Nations squad. The four players have previously represented Wales and have gained 85 caps between them. Amy Day gained her 50th cap in France in the World Cup and has represented Wales an impressive 54 times.
Amy stated that it’s a massive honour to represent her country and that she cannot wait to take the field this Sunday against England. Jenny Hawkins, Laurie Harris and Robyn Wilkins all made their debuts last year against Italy in the opening game of the 2014 tournament.
When Laurie was asked about the experience she agreed that it is a privilege to be representing Welsh Women’s rugby in this six nations campaign, she described an amazing buzz around the camp for this weekend’s game against England.
Jenny describes the whole experience as incredible. With all the hard work and the effort the girls have put in over the last few months Robyn stated how the girls are keen to get the campaign underway and put into practice what they have learnt.
The home fixtures are held in St Helens RFC, Swansea, Wales play England on Sunday 8th February at 2:30pm and Ireland at home on the 15th of March at 12pm.
